Assuming they have the same model, the finaincing is not for them to own aircraft but to order and take delivery. Their model is as faras I know still to sell the aircraft to an end user who leases it back.
If that is the case, obviously where they would get into trouble is a worldwide recession and inability to place the deliveries.
Secondly they lease them to charter them. If that market goes away, then the commitment ot the existing owners may be strained.
